Vouch turns your wider network into the goldmine it is: your own, trusted sourcing team.
Modern agencies use Vouch
Empower your recruitment strategy with multi-channel referrals, smart automations, and engaging job postings that help you deliver superior candidates.
Extend your talent reach
Leverage Vouch-powered referrals across job boards, LinkedIn, social media, and your own networks to tap into hidden pools of high-quality talent.

Turn rejections into opportunity
Re-engage past candidates and maximize every interaction by converting prior engagements into fresh talent referrals.

On brand for every client
Easily launch client-branded portals, polished job pages and multi-channel referrals campaigns in minutes.

Screen faster with confidence
Combine referrals data, AI-enhanced profiles, and customizable role-fit criteria to quickly identify and engage the best candidates.

Smart profile summaries
AI-enhanced profile summaries merge insights from LinkedIn, resumes, custom candidate questions, and more.

Role fit customization
Assign an importance rating to each role requirement to customize how candidate fit is calculated.

Delightful user experience
Elegant, mobile-first application experiences that boost candidate engagement and conversion.
Effortlessly manage multiple client portfolios
Vouch makes it easy to manage client portfolios of any size, with support for multi-tenant workspaces and client-unique branding.


Multi-tenancy
Manage multiple clients within the same Vouch workspace.
Client-specific branding
Create client-specific campaign assets .
Sync with your ATS
Automatically sync jobs, candidates, and referrals with existing systems.
More value with Vouch
Strengthen client relationships and boost revenue streams through our strategic partner program.

Faster placements
Reduce time-to-hire and accelerate revenues on every role placement.

Less time on admin
Simplify client management and increase services revenues with AI-native capabilities.

Thanks for the love
Get 15% commission on subscription fees for 2 years for every new client you bring to Vouch.

It's easy to get started
Start from
It's easy to get started. Just paste in your company's website, and we will get started on a first draft of your company profile. Try Vouch for free during a 7 day trial.
Company Website

Build beautiful listings
Share to networks
Get qualified candidates